Preheat oven to 500 degrees F. Set prime rib on the rack of a … mayo clinic small fiber neuropathy panelWebOct 30, 2024 · Rule #8: Roast Low and Slow. The higher the temeprature you cook your meat at, the greater the temperature gradient within your meat will be, meaning by the time the center of your meat is a perfect medium-rare, the outer layers will be overcooked. You end up with a rosy red center, but dry, gray outer layers. mayo clinic smart goalsWebDirections preheat the oven to 500 degrees f (260 degrees c).
